anxiety-management

Vocabulary Word

Definition
Anxiety-management refers to a set of techniques and strategies used to help control feelings of anxiety. Think of them as a toolkit for calming yourself down when worry starts building up.
Examples in Different Contexts
In workplace wellbeing, 'anxiety management' involves creating an environment that supports employees in managing stress and anxiety. An HR manager might explain, 'Our company offers workshops on anxiety management to improve overall employee wellness and productivity.'
